Using Masking for Focused Edits
Masking helps direct attention to the subject. Instead of editing the whole image, users can adjust specific areas.
Moreover, AI tools simplify selection. Because of this, editing becomes faster and more accurate.
Common uses include:
- Highlighting the subject
- Blurring or darkening backgrounds
- Enhancing the sky or scenery
- Adjusting facial lighting
In addition, it improves visual storytelling.
Optimizing Images for Social Platforms
Different platforms require different image formats. Instead of one-size editing, optimization is important.
Moreover, Lightroom supports flexible export settings. Because of this, images remain high quality across platforms.
Best practices include:
- Using JPEG for fast uploads
- Setting resolution based on the platform
- Maintaining sRGB color profile
- Compressing without losing detail
As a result, images look consistent everywhere.
